Since opening its doors in 2015, the Beijing Advanced Innovation Center
for Structural Biology (ICSB) at Tsinghua University has quickly gained
a reputation for producing prolific amounts of high-quality research in
the life sciences.
In four years, the center has published 50 high-impact research
papers in Nature, Science, and Cell, and helped define and develop this
rapidly developing field in China, says Yigong Shi, director of the ICSB.
The former dean of the School of Life Sciences at Tsinghua University
dramatically advanced the field of molecular biology with his ground-
breaking discoveries about spliceosomes, the cellular machines that
make all of the proteins our bodies need to function. Shi explains that
the senior faculty at the center are training the next generation of
exceptional scientists while simultaneously producing world-leading
basic and translational research.
“The institute put itself on the map when my team published
the first near-atomic-resolution structure of the spliceosome. Some
scientists have called this discovery one of the holy grails of structural
biology,” says Shi, who won China’s foremost science award, the Future
Science Prize, in 2017. “Our research improved our understanding of basic
biological processes and should help to identify new drug targets in
the future.”

A collaborative approachThe field of structural biology demands a cross-disciplinary approach,
and the ICSB has poured resources into creating a team of scientists, from
areas such as computing, electronics, mechanical engineering, chemistry,
physics, maths, and biology, that can work together with biophysicists,
structural biologists, and cell biologists to work on key problems and
produce major breakthroughs.
Hongwei Wang, who earned his undergraduate degree and Ph.D. at
Tsinghua University, researches cryo-electron microscopy (cryo-EM)—a
tool that can help researchers examine the structures of macromolecules
at extremely high resolutions. According to Wang, one of the greatest
challenges in his field of research is to build a team with a wide enough
disciplinary background to handle the challenges posed by the projects.
“I have built strong collaborations with scientists in nano-material
science and scientists in precision instrument implementation to tackle
the major technical challenges, such as cryo-EM specimen preparation
and cryo-EM structural analysis throughput,” he says.
Most recently, Wang and his team helped set a world record for the
smallest protein (52 kDa streptavidin) to be solved at atomic resolution
using single-particle cryo-EM reconstruction. Using cryo-EM, he and his
team hope to solve a wide range of drug target macromolecules
in their relative native states without crystallization, which
could lead to more efficient drug discoveries.

Designs on healthWhile researchers at the ICSB are devoted to unraveling the mysteries
of life at an atomic level, they are also keen to see their work solve real-
life problems in the future.
Haitao Li researches the biological mechanisms that switch genes
on or off at the chromosomal level—a field called epigenetics—and
explores how drugs can be developed to treat medical conditions, such as
cancer, heart diseases, and diabetes, which are influenced by epigenetic
dysfunction.
For example, his laboratory has recently identified how the YEATS
domain proteins relate to the development of leukemia and developed
compounds that can be used in ENL gene-targeted therapy. Li works
closely with hospitals across China and thinks there will be many
opportunities to translate his basic research into applications for the
benefit of patients, given the strong support he receives from the
ICSB.
Scientists at the center benefit from state-of-the-art facilities, such
as high-end cryo-EM machines, and proteomic and imaging core facilities,
he says. In addition, there is an ethos of intellectual curiosity that enables
groundbreaking work.
“The mission of the center is to resolve the mystery of biological
structures in diverse functional systems of life,” he says. “We are given
the freedom to choose our projects, aim high, and think deeply.”
Xinquan Wang, a biophysicist, agrees that these factors will help
scientists at ICSB translate research that can benefit the health of
Chinese citizens. His group is researching the structure of the interleukin 1
family of cell-surface receptors. Wang hopes their study will enable the
development of antibodies that are able to modulate the activities of
these receptors, which are linked to inflammation in the body.
He uses cutting-edge X-ray crystallography and cryo-EM tools in his
work, but adds that he and his team need to combine structural biology
methods with other functional techniques to gain more insights into the
scientific questions.
“Collaboration is also important for our study, especially for applying
the knowledge from our research to the development of agents with
potential therapeutic applications,” he says.
Looking to the futureShi has his sights set on new avenues of scientific enquiry that will
open up possibilities for cellular research at ICSB and Tsinghua University.
For instance, he is interested in how biological systems interact with
electromagnetic waves.
“On the pragmatic side, the applications of this kind of research
could be enormous,” he says. “For example, if electromagnetic waves of a
longer wavelength can induce a specific interaction in cells, which leads
to cell death in cancer cells, then that could be used as a therapy to treat
cancer patients.”
The prize-winning scientist highlights that there are many forces
interacting with our bodies that are unknown to us.
“There are many things we don’t know because we don’t see them.
Using state-of-the-art tools, we can gain a glimpse into this process,”
he says. “To me, this is an enormously interesting area that has not been
explored by many scientists.”
